Longtime Jockey Agent Dominguez Dies

Juan A. Dominguez Sr. died Sunday morning after a brief illness. In Dominguez's long career as a jockey agent, he handled the book for riders such as Eddie Maple, Miguel Rivera, Ruben Hernandez, and Eclipse Award winning apprentice Ramon Perez.

The funeral will be held Wednesday at Holy Road Cemetery in Westbury, New York, following a mass to be held at Blessed Sacrament Roman Catholic Church in Valley Stream, New York. Visitation will take place from 2-5 p.m. and 7-10 p.m Monday and Tuesday at Krauss Funeral Home in Franklin Square, New York.
